33 lines
1.3 KiB
Markdown
33 lines
1.3 KiB
Markdown
|
---
|
|||
|
title: Write Reusable JavaScript with Functions
|
|||
|
localeTitle: Запись многоразового JavaScript с функциями
|
|||
|
---
|
|||
|
В JavaScript мы можем разделить наш код на многократно используемые функции, называемые функциями.
|
|||
|
|
|||
|
Вот пример функции:
|
|||
|
```
|
|||
|
function functionName() {
|
|||
|
console.log("Hello World");
|
|||
|
}
|
|||
|
```
|
|||
|
|
|||
|
Вы можете `call` или `invoke` эту функцию, используя ее имя, за которым следуют скобки, например:
|
|||
|
```
|
|||
|
functionName();
|
|||
|
```
|
|||
|
|
|||
|
Каждый раз, когда функция вызывается, она выводит сообщение «Hello World» на консоль dev. Весь код между фигурными фигурными скобками будет выполняться каждый раз, когда вызывается функция.
|
|||
|
|
|||
|
Вот еще один пример:
|
|||
|
```
|
|||
|
function otherFunctionName (a, b) {
|
|||
|
return(a + b);
|
|||
|
}
|
|||
|
```
|
|||
|
|
|||
|
Мы можем `call` или `invoke` нашу функцию следующим образом:
|
|||
|
```
|
|||
|
otherFunctionName(1,2);
|
|||
|
```
|
|||
|
|
|||
|
и он запустится и вернет нам возвращаемое значение.
|